Sadhguru was interviewed by the New Indian Express newspaper when he was in Bangalore recently. He spoke about Isha’s various social outreach programs, including Project GreenHands, Isha Vidhya, and the Government School Adoption Program and its future plans. “We have set a goal to adopt 3,000 government schools in Tamil Nadu in the next 10 years,” said Sadhguru.

He also spoke about how India has always been steeped in spiritual processes, and about Isha’s efforts to create “the required infrastructure to provide spiritual education to as many people as possible.” Establishing a center in Bangalore is a part of these efforts. Sadhguru concluded by speaking about Adiyogi, “Everything is already revealed by the Adiyogi and we are trying to revive what has been forgotten. Unlike others who are steeped in philosophical polemics, our teachings are based on our personal experiences. They are scientific and can be tested.”
